    Abstract: A connection recovery apparatus for placing a dynamic connection of a dynamic switch of a computer I/O system in a known state upon the detection of a possible switching error. The I/O system includes transmitting stations each having a link-level facility attached by a link to a dynamic-switch port of a dynamic-switch. The dynamic-switch makes dynamic connections between any two of the stations. Upon the detection of a possible switching error, the detecting link-level facility of a station or its attached dynamic-switch port starts a switch recovery procedure which places any dynamic connection to that station in a known disconnected state.

    Abstract: An apparatus and method for protecting BIOS stored on a direct access storage device into a personnal computer system. The personal computer system comprises a system processor, a system planar, a random access main memory, a read only memory, a protection means and at least one direct access storage device. The read only memory includes a first portion of BIOS and data representing the type of system processor and system planar I/O configuration. The first portion of BIOS initializes the system and the direct access storage device, and resets the protection means in order to read in a master boot record into the random access memory from a protectable partition on the direct access storage device.

    Abstract: A method for rendering or compositing image components, where at least one of the image components has an edge. The edge is rendered or composited a plurality of times, the repetitions being performed with different values of the edge thickness (i.e., the thickness of the line) and with different opacities. This makes it possible to create in this way an opacity gradient or the like, so that the edge may be given a softer and less abrupt appearance, if such is desired.

    Abstract: A fluid processing assembly can be easily inserted into and removed from a rotatable centrifuge channel. The processing assembly comprises a processing container and a carrier. The processing container has flexibility and, in use, occupies the channel to receive fluids for separation in the centrifugal field. The carrier retains the processing container outside the channel in a flexed condition conforming to the channel. The carrier resists deformation of the processing container during its insertion into or removal from the channel.

    Abstract: A system and method are provided for deinterleaving differential inverse multiplexed (DIM) virtual channels in a 40G Ethernet receiver. The method accepts a 10.3125 gigabits per second (Gbps) (10G) Ethernet virtual channel with 64B/86B blocks, including periodic Lane Alignment Marker (LAM) blocks. The 10G virtual channel is deinterleaved into two 5.15625 Gbps (5G) virtual channels by: 1) deinterleaving consecutive blocks from the 10G virtual channel into the 5G virtual channels in an alternating order, and 2) reversing the order of deinterleaving in response to each detected LAM block. Then, the method supplies the 5G virtual channels (i.e. to a MAC module).
